Elements Influencing Back Door Installation Prices
Several factors play an essential function in figuring out the overall cost of back door installation. Comprehending these components can help house owners budget plan properly.
Type of Door: The choice of the door product and design significantly impacts expenses. Typical types include:
- Wooden Doors: Aesthetic and standard but normally more costly due to product expenses.
- Fiberglass Doors: Durable and energy-efficient with medium price points.
- Steel Doors: Typically the most affordable, providing security but less visual appeal.
- Size of the Door: Standard door sizes generally cost less than custom sizes. Homeowners require to think about whether they desire a standard-sized door or a larger, custom-made service.
- Installation Complexity: If the installation requires comprehensive modifications to walls or frames, expenses will increase. Basic installations are more cost-effective compared to complicated setups.
- Labor Costs: The geographical area and the contractor's experience impact labor expenses. Urban areas typically have higher labor rates compared to rural areas.
- Extra Features: Security features such as locks, wise technology, and ornamental components can increase the general cost. Installation of features like storm doors may likewise include to expenditures.
- Licenses and Warranties: Some setups might require a license depending on local structure codes. Additionally, warranties on doors or installation services can affect total rates.
Common Price Ranges for Back Door Installation
To provide property owners with a benchmark, the following table lays out the common expenses related to back entrance installation:
Type of Door | Typical Cost (Materials Only) | Average Installation Cost | Total Estimated Cost |
---|---|---|---|
Wooden Door | ₤ 800 - ₤ 2,500 | ₤ 300 - ₤ 500 | ₤ 1,100 - ₤ 3,000 |
Fiberglass Door | ₤ 600 - ₤ 1,500 | ₤ 300 - ₤ 500 | ₤ 900 - ₤ 2,000 |
Steel Door | ₤ 400 - ₤ 1,200 | ₤ 300 - ₤ 500 | ₤ 700 - ₤ 1,700 |
Custom Door | ₤ 1,200 - ₤ 5,000 or more | ₤ 500 - ₤ 1,000 | ₤ 1,700 - ₤ 6,000+ |
Additional Considerations for Back Door Installation
While budgeting for back door installation, property owners should consider the following:
- Energy Efficiency Ratings: Investing in a door with excellent insulation properties can lead to cost savings on energy expenses in the long run.
- Weatherproofing Measures: Ensure that the installation includes sufficient weather condition removing to secure versus water and air leakages.
- Insurance coverage: Some home insurance policies may offer discounts for setting up tougher security doors.
- Maintenance: Understand the upkeep requirements related to different materials. For example, wooden doors may require more upkeep compared to fiberglass or steel options.
